Kitchen Planning

Now that I've finished the bathroom (I'll pop up a little post this Sunday!) I've moved onto planning my dream kitchen. Whilst there's not much I can do about the dreary beige speckled countertops (forever dreaming of marble surfaces) I've been adding decor, cutlery and serving ware to my wishlist in the hopes that when we own our own home one day it will all fit together nicely!

Starting with a huge clear out of my kitchen, I'm planning on following the Kondo method - keeping only the things that I love and things that are useful. It's so great to pull absolutely everything out to sort through and clean, check sell by dates and organise before wiping down all my cupboards and surfaces and tidying them away! 

My colour scheme plans for the kitchen are white, wood, gold, marble and grey. I'm aiming for a crisp, clean space with gold detailing, marble surfaces and a pop of greenery from fresh herbs and plants. 
I would love my kitchen to be somewhere that inspires me to be healthy, cook from scratch and eat well.
